Why Buy Subaru from USA
Copart and IAAI auctions list 200-500 Subaru vehicles daily. The average price for a 2018-2020 Forester is $8,000-$12,000, which is 35-40% cheaper than the European market. This cost advantage makes purchasing a Subaru from the USA an attractive option for many buyers.
Most Popular Subaru Models at Auction
Among the most sought-after Subaru models at auction are the Impreza, WRX, and Outback. The Impreza is known for its compact size and all-wheel-drive capability, making it a great choice for city driving and winter conditions alike. The WRX, with its sporty performance and turbocharged engine, appeals to enthusiasts looking for a fun ride. Finally, the Outback blends the practicality of an SUV with the handling of a wagon, ideal for families and adventure seekers.
What to Look for When Choosing
When selecting a Subaru at auction, keep an eye out for specific damage types. Avoid vehicles with frame damage, as repairs can be costly and may affect safety. Look for a mileage count under 70,000 miles, as Subarus are known for their longevity but can start to experience issues after that mark. Models from 2016 and later generally have fewer reported problems, whereas earlier models, particularly those before 2015, may have issues with head gaskets, especially in the Legacy.
How Much Does It Cost to Import Subaru
Understanding the total cost of importing a Subaru is essential. For example, if you win a bid on a car for $10,000, you should factor in shipping costs of around $1,800 and customs fees ranging from $2,500 to $4,000. This brings your total cost to approximately $14,000-$16,000. For a more detailed breakdown, you can use our calculator.
